    Three Kosovo Serbs Sentenced for 2023 Deadly Gun Battle and Siege

    Web DeskBy Web DeskApril 24, 2026No Comments1 Min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    In a significant development, Kosovo’s judiciary has delivered verdicts against three Kosovo Serbs involved in a violent incident in 2023. Two of the accused were sentenced to life imprisonment, while the third received a 30-year prison term. The attack included a deadly gun battle and a siege of a monastery, events that shocked the region and heightened ethnic tensions.

    The 2023 attack was notable for its intensity and the targeting of a religious site, which underscored the fragile security situation in Kosovo. The monastery, a symbol of cultural and religious heritage, became a focal point of violence, drawing international concern. This case highlights ongoing challenges in maintaining peace and security in areas with ethnic divisions.

    Meanwhile, the court’s decision sends a strong message about accountability and the rule of law in Kosovo. It aims to deter future acts of violence and promote stability in the region. The sentences also reflect efforts to address past conflicts and support reconciliation processes amid Kosovo’s complex political landscape.
